Flomen Last Name Facts

Where Does The Last Name Flomen Come From? nationality or country of origin

The surname Flomen (Marathi: ोमेन, Russian: Фломен) occurs in Canada more than any other country or territory. It can also occur as a variant: Flomén. For other possible spellings of Flomen click here.

How Common Is The Last Name Flomen? popularity and diffusion

This surname is the 2,580,327th most numerous family name on a worldwide basis. It is borne by approximately 1 in 130,134,748 people. The last name Flomen occurs predominantly in The Americas, where 79 percent of Flomen reside; 75 percent reside in North America and 59 percent reside in Anglo-North America. Flomen is also the 2,136,160th most commonly held given name at a global level, held by 25 people.

The last name Flomen is most commonly held in Canada, where it is borne by 27 people, or 1 in 1,364,652. In Canada it is primarily concentrated in: Ontario, where 74 percent live and Quebec, where 26 percent live. Aside from Canada Flomen occurs in 10 countries. It is also found in The United States, where 23 percent live and England, where 11 percent live.

Flomen Family Population Trend historical fluctuation

The incidence of Flomen has changed through the years. In The United States the number of people carrying the Flomen last name grew 650 percent between 1880 and 2014.
